    Triple off-set butterfly valve sealing in reverse direction

    The API 609 2016 now provides more detail of the triple offset design, by way of cross sectional details. It is grouped as earlier under the category B type. It requires to be specified by the user, if the bi-directional attribute is required. It is not implicit in terms such as 'high...
  12. svi

    Triple off-set butterfly valve sealing in reverse direction

    Manufactures claim on literature that the triple off-set butterfly valves are sealing in both directions. But from experience it is known that the valve does not hold effectively against the normal flow direction. The valve standard API 609 does not address whether there is an inherent design...

    ASME Standard for Full threaded stud bolt used with Flange Joints

    The understanding per B31.3 2016 is that the threads for the full depth of the nuts are to engage. This is a change from the earlier revision of the code. This would mean that at least 1 pitch extension should be included in the stud length.
